Director of Communications and Public Engagement (Volunteer) Organization Mentor A Promise (MAP) Division Communications and Creative Media Location Remote Type Volunteer (Unpaid) About Mentor A Promise Mentor A Promise (MAP) is a nonprofit organization dedicated to supporting children and youth ages 5–18 experiencing housing instability in New York City. Through mentorship, academic enrichment, literacy development, creative expression, and housing initiatives, MAP creates safe, consistent, and empowering spaces where young people can thrive. MAP’s Communications & Creative Media Division tells the stories that shape our movement. Through visual media, storytelling, and digital engagement, the division amplifies the voices of youth and communities — ensuring every message, image, and sound reflects our mission of hope, resilience, and equity. Our multimedia initiatives include- Threads of Voices – MAP’s storytelling and podcast platform highlighting real voices of mentorship, artistry, and transformation.
- The Bells I Hear – a digital audio series exploring themes of belonging, memory, and community through sound and story.
- MAP’s YouTube Channel – home to original content, interviews, and youth-centered storytelling.
- Social Media Campaigns – mission-driven visuals and narratives shared across Instagram, X, LinkedIn, and other digital platforms.
